Early Life and Origins: A Glimpse into Her Background

Ilona Maher's journey began in Burlington, Vermont, where she was born on August 12, 1996. Her family background is a blend of cultures; she was born to Michael and Mieneke Maher. Her mother, Mieneke, is a Dutch native who works as a nurse, while her father, Michael, has Irish ancestry. Growing up in Burlington, Vermont, Ilona was surrounded by a supportive environment that fostered her athletic pursuits. The "Transvestigator" Phenomenon: Broader Context

The allegations against Ilona Maher are not isolated incidents. She, alongside other prominent female athletes like Imane Khelif, has become a target of what are known as "transvestigators." These individuals or groups actively seek to "expose" cisgender female athletes as transgender, often based on nothing more than their physical appearance or athletic performance. This rhetoric ignores the fundamental fact that these athletes are cisgender women and contributes to a harmful environment of suspicion and harassment. The phenomenon highlights a disturbing trend of policing women's bodies in sports, particularly when they excel in ways that challenge preconceived notions.
